another thing....since I have a later engine, and O/drive auto with 336 rear, getting ~23-4 mpg......while cruising at 90 I wonder about going to a milder rear and IF that would do jack diddly about fuel economy...308? anyone....anyone have any factual knowledge on this....or personal observations???
 
another thing....since I have a later engine, and O/drive auto with 336 rear, getting ~23-4 mpg......while cruising at 90 I wonder about going to a milder rear and IF that would do jack diddly about fuel economy...308? anyone....anyone have any factual knowledge on this....or personal observations???


Personal Observation..I went from 308 to 336. Although it's been a while, I am probably running 150-200RPM's higher in 4th on my Muncie when cruising at 65-70mph. It is slightly quicker off the line with the 336. My guess is you would maybe get a mile or 2 more a gallon. I doubt if you would be able to tell the difference.
